The Foundation: Blood Sugar Regulation and Its Significance

Blood sugar regulation is a finely tuned process orchestrated by the body to ensure a steady supply of energy for cellular functions. The hormone insulin, produced by the pancreas, plays a central role in this regulation, facilitating the uptake of glucose by cells. However, disruptions in this delicate balance can have far-reaching implications, extending beyond metabolic health to potentially impact cancer risk.

Blood Sugar, Insulin, and Cancer: The Interplay

Elevated blood sugar levels often coincide with higher insulin levels. Persistent elevation of insulin, as seen in conditions like insulin resistance and type 2 diabetes, has been linked to an increased risk of various cancers. The interplay between blood sugar, insulin, and cancer risk is multifaceted and involves several key mechanisms.

  1. Insulin and Cell Growth: Insulin is not only involved in glucose uptake but also plays a role in cell growth and division. Elevated insulin levels can promote the proliferation of cells, including cancer cells. This increased cell growth is a fundamental aspect of cancer development and progression.
  2. Inflammation and Cancer: Chronic inflammation, often associated with elevated blood sugar levels, has been identified as a potential driver of cancer. Inflammatory processes can create an environment conducive to cancer development by promoting DNA damage and supporting the survival of abnormal cells.
  3. Insulin-Like Growth Factor (IGF): Insulin shares similarities with insulin-like growth factor (IGF), a hormone that also influences cell growth. Elevated levels of IGF, often observed in conditions of insulin resistance, may contribute to uncontrolled cell proliferation and increase the risk of cancer.

Blood Sugar, Type 2 Diabetes, and Cancer Risk

Type 2 diabetes, characterized by insulin resistance and elevated blood sugar levels, has been consistently associated with an increased risk of certain cancers. Individuals with type 2 diabetes may have a higher likelihood of developing cancers of the liver, pancreas, colon, breast, and endometrium.

The underlying connection lies in the common denominator of elevated insulin levels and chronic inflammation. Both factors create an environment that can facilitate the initiation and progression of cancer cells.

Lifestyle Factors and Blood Sugar: Impact on Cancer Risk

  1. Dietary Choices: Adopting a diet that helps maintain stable blood sugar levels is key in mitigating cancer risk. Focus on whole, nutrient-dense foods, such as fruits, vegetables, whole grains, and lean proteins, while minimizing the intake of processed sugars and refined carbohydrates.
  2. Physical Activity: Regular physical activity has multiple benefits, including improved insulin sensitivity and blood sugar regulation. Engaging in exercise can contribute to a lower risk of developing type 2 diabetes and, subsequently, certain cancers.
  3. Weight Management: Maintaining a healthy weight is crucial for both blood sugar control and reducing cancer risk. Excess body weight, especially abdominal fat, is associated with insulin resistance and a higher likelihood of developing various cancers.
  4. Moderation in Alcohol Consumption: Excessive alcohol consumption can contribute to elevated blood sugar levels and increase the risk of certain cancers. Moderation in alcohol intake is advisable, with guidelines suggesting up to one drink per day for women and up to two drinks per day for men.
  5. Regular Health Check-ups: Routine health check-ups, including blood sugar monitoring, are essential for early detection of any abnormalities. Timely intervention and management of conditions like prediabetes or insulin resistance can contribute to reducing cancer risk.
